Specialized equipment and trailers for turbine hauling

Gas and steam turbines usually need more than a standard flatbed. Depending on the footprint and axle loading, we may use RGNs, lowboys, step decks, double drops, or multi-axle trailers to keep the machine within legal and structural limits. Heavy Haulers choose the trailer based on length, height, weight distribution, and whether the turbine is shipping with skids, frames, or accessory modules. A lowboy can help reduce overall height, while an RGN may make loading and positioning easier for oversized machinery. Multi-axle setups spread weight across the roadway and help protect bridges and pavement. Heavy Haul Transporting also reviews tie-down points, blocking requirements, and the load’s balance before dispatch. For some moves, flatbed trucking companies would not have the right configuration, which is why specialized heavy haul trucking matters. The goal is simple: match the trailer to the cargo, then move it with enough clearance and control for a smooth road trip from the port gate to the destination site.

Permits, escorts, and route planning in Washington

Washington oversize moves require careful permit work, and turbines can trigger both oversize and overweight conditions. Heavy Haulers review width, height, length, and gross weight before the truck ever reaches the road. In the Port of Ilwaco, WA area, route planning often starts with Highway 101 and the coastal connector roads, then expands to the wider network toward Interstate 5 when the destination is inland. Route surveys matter because bridge clearances, shoulder widths, turning radii, and local road restrictions can change the plan fast. Some loads need pilot cars or escorts, especially when height or width exceeds standard thresholds. Heavy Haul Transporting checks state permit conditions, travel windows, and any city or county limits that affect oversize loads. We also verify overhead signs, utility lines, and tight intersections before dispatch. Heavy Haulers work through these details early so the truck can move with fewer surprises and fewer stops once it leaves the terminal area.
